I am using GA App in Matlab but by writing my own functions for Population creation, Crossover and Mutation. My population individuals are nxn matrices with 0 and 1 as elements. These matrices are evaluated by my Fitness function which returns a vector of scalar scores ( Vectorized = 'On' ).
In the GA App I choose the options ' Proportional ' for FitnessScaling and ' Roulette ' for Selection .
My problem is that after the scores calculation at the FitnessFcn the Optimization stops with the error " Conversion to double from cell is not possible " . And I do not understand where this error come from, either during Scaling or Selection . Is there anyway to identify the error source? I suspect that it is related to the fact that my population are matrices stored in cell arrays.
Does this mean that I also have to write my own Scaling and Selection functions? Or is there any other way to tackle it?

dbstop if error
And look around

Just run the above at the command line. It turns on the debugger to stop automatically whenever an error is thrown. You can then see everything as it is at the time of the error. The bad function line/variable will probably stand out at this point.
